10 puntos por xguru 2021-01-21 | 2 comentarios | Compartir por WhatsApp
  • Incrusta SQLite en Cloudflare Workers con WASM y guarda los datos en Workers KV

  • Usa funciones serverless como si fueran una base de datos remota

→ Un enfoque que llama SQL directamente de forma remota para leer datos

  • Puede usarse cuando se quiere usar un conjunto de datos de solo lectura en lugar de una API REST
  • Los datos de ejemplo son datos de tipos de cambio del Banco Central Europeo

2 comentarios

 
chiwanpark 2021-01-21

También existe el paquete sql.js, creado para facilitar el uso del resultado de compilación de SQLite a WASM. https://github.com/sql-js/sql.js

 
xguru 2021-01-21

SQLite en sí mismo originalmente es verdaderamente serverless, sin servidor, pero aquí: https://www.sqlite.org/serverless.html

Aquí, "serverless" se refiere a la forma de ejecutar SQLite sobre Function as a Service.

Parece que se puede usar para varios propósitos. En especial, da la impresión de que encajaría muy bien con Workers de Cloudflare, que casi no tiene latencia.

Workers tiene un límite de 100 mil consultas por día y 1000 requests por minuto, así que se puede usar sin problema para APIs simples.

https://developers.cloudflare.com/workers/platform/limits